    I updated my phone today to CyanogenMod 14.1. Nougat 7.1. and i have several problems, first one is i can’t open youtube, it is just stuck on screen with youtube logo and wont load up, next problem is i can’t open Google Chrome, when i try to open it, it just crashes, next is google play store, i get errors every second that google play store is stopped working, and because of that i can’t open any of my games that are on the phone, any solutions?

    #9652
    Linux User
    Participant

    @4m2ww

    Yes i had the same problem. You have to update your g-apps as well.

    https://cyanogenmods.org/forums/topic/download-android-nougat-cyanogenmod-14-google-apps-gapps/

    choose your version (Android 7.1) and the variant. Download the zip, drop it in /sdcard and start your phone in recovery-mode then install from sdcard and your’e done.

    But i got still problems with other apps, especially the internal “Clock”-app, it crashes instantly, as well as spotify etc.

    Couldn’t find any solutions there yet

    Update to myself:

    If you guys are experiencing similar problems with “in-build” apps: deactivate them through the app-manager and then reactivate.

    If you guys are experiencing similar problems with “off-build” apps: simply reinstall them. Then they should work properly.

    This worked for me in all cases, for now.

    Hi, thank you for your reply, I did as you said, flashed gapps to my phone, but i flashed full version, i did not know which one to choose, but, now my phone is full of ther apps, (google play music, movies, fittnes, gmail, google+, hangouts and othes) and i can’t uninstall them, any help about that please?

    #9691
    Linux User
    Participant

    @4m2ww

    The easyiest way would be flashing the cm-version you’re using completly new but WITHOUT making a wipe/data reset (so that your stuff will be untouched). Then you can flash the gapps you want (i.e. gapps mini). You can see whats in the package if you click on the little symbol right next to the title.

    If thats too risky for you then use this app
    https://www.apk4fun.com/apk/985/
    BUT be careful what you delete.
